The Compliance Division oversees all facets of tax processing, issuances of business permits, and alcohol regulation throughout the state. From the receipt of individual and business tax returns and payments, audits and collections, to routine compliance inspections and regulatory verification of alcohol-licensed establishments, this division is tasked with upholding, enforcing and educating taxpayers and licensees on Iowa’s laws and regulations.In this position you will: Review audits completed by lower-level auditors to ensure accuracy of and proper interpretation of laws, rules, and/or procedures Resolve escalated tax questions asked by auditors or taxpayers Provide coaching and counseling to lower-level auditors and communicate observed training needs to auditor supervisors In conjunction with other Tax Gap auditors, establish and review measurements to monitor processes Analyze internal controls of accounting procedures to determine the accuracy of tax records Conduct complex individual income tax audits by independently performing audit investigations to ensure correct reporting and computing Iowa tax liability Contact taxpayers or representatives by letter, by phone or in-person to communicate findings Assist in developing selective audit criteria Preference will be given to candidates with the following: Prior experience training on processes and procedures, answering questions and mentoring peers Experience preparing, reviewing or auditing tax returns Experience performing audits and following audit procedures Job Specific Competencies: Accounting and Auditing – Professional accounting and auditing theory, methods, standards, and procedures Law and Government – Understand and adhere to applicable laws, legal codes, administrative rules, and regulations Deductive Reasoning – Apply general rules to specific problems to produce answers that make sense Inductive Reasoning – Combine pieces of information to form general rules or conclusions Critical Thinking – Using logic and reasoning to identify the strengths and weaknesses of alternative solutions, conclusions or approaches to problems Employer Highlights:The Iowa Department of Revenue is a well-respected employer. For more information, please visitMinimum Qualification RequirementsApplicants must meet at least one of the following minimum requirements to qualify for positions in this job classification:1.) Graduation from an accredited four-year college or university with a degree in accounting or finance, and experience equal to two and a half years of full-time work in professional accounting or financial auditing. Graduation from an accredited four-year college or university with a minimum of nine semester hours in accounting, and experience equal to three years of full-time work in professional accounting or financial auditing. Possession of a Certified Public Accountant (CPA) certificate, graduation from an accredited four-year college or university, and experience equal to one year of full-time work in professional accounting or financial auditing. Graduation from an accredited college or university with a Master’s degree in accounting, taxation, business administration, or a related field, and experience equal to one year of full-time work in professional accounting or financial auditing. Number 1 or 2 above, where each year of full-time work experience in public or private sector accounting, auditing, budgeting, assessment, computation, or collection of taxes, or closely-related financial functions may substitute for thirty semester hours of the required education. Current, continuous experience in the state executive branch that includes experience equal to two years of full-time work as a Revenue Auditor 2.
